Noun

1. abstract expressionism, action painting

a New York school of painting characterized by freely created abstractions; the first important school of American painting to develop independently of European styles

noun
a school of painting in New York in the 1940s that combined the spontaneity of expressionism with abstract forms in unpremeditated, apparently random, compositions
See also action painting, tachisme
